非page组件,有没有类似onPageShow、onPageHide的系统回调方法,用于判断当前组件是否离开页面

有一些组件上需要显示实时信息,存在定时刷新的逻辑,为了降低系统资源占用,当这些组件不可见的时候暂停掉相关的定时器,在组件恢复可见的时候再开启定时轮询

HarmonyOS
2024-04-29 21:43:06
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
koarla

组件可见区域变化事件是组件在屏幕中的显示区域面积变化时触发的事件,提供了判断组件是否完全或部分显示在屏幕中的能力。

请参考以下文档:https://developer.huawei.com/consumer/cn/doc/harmonyos-references/ts-universal-component-visible-area-change-event-0000001815767708

分享
微博
QQ
微信
回复
2024-04-30 20:47:42
相关问题
HarmonyOS 组件是否有销毁方法
435浏览 • 1回复 待解决
鸿蒙有没有类似viewpage组件
7750浏览 • 1回复 已解决
HarmonyOS 有没有类似scrollview组件
238浏览 • 1回复 待解决
弹窗组件无法进入onPageShow方法
2077浏览 • 1回复 待解决
HarmonyOS Web组件
127浏览 • 1回复 待解决
组件设置visibility属性
457浏览 • 2回复 待解决